IN SEARCH OF HIDDEN SECTOR THROUGH THE MONO-PHOTON CHANNEL
Sartaş, Enfal; Turan, İsmail; Department of Physics (2022-12-02)
A growing body of experimental and observational evidence shows that Standard Model calculations account for only 5% of the mass and energy of the universe. The remainder consists of dark matter and dark energy, which have yet to be observed. The existence of dark matter, first discovered by Fritz Zwicky, suggests the presence of a hidden sector that is almost neutral under any of the forces predicted by the Standard Model.
